Option select on tput working or use old fallback control codes

This commit is contained in:
Andrew R. M 2025-04-04 17:42:35 +00:00
parent 9455e8c6a9
commit e80f4e87e7

View File

@ -2,6 +2,7 @@
#{- PROMPT -}# #{- PROMPT -}#
if which tput &> /dev/null && tput bold &> /dev/null; then
red="\001$(tput bold)$(tput setaf 1)\002" red="\001$(tput bold)$(tput setaf 1)\002"
green="\001$(tput bold)$(tput setaf 2)\002" green="\001$(tput bold)$(tput setaf 2)\002"
yellow="\001$(tput bold)$(tput setaf 3)\002" yellow="\001$(tput bold)$(tput setaf 3)\002"
@ -9,6 +10,15 @@ blue="\001$(tput bold)$(tput setaf 4)\002"
magenta="\001$(tput bold)$(tput setaf 5)\002" magenta="\001$(tput bold)$(tput setaf 5)\002"
cyan="\001$(tput bold)$(tput setaf 6)\002" cyan="\001$(tput bold)$(tput setaf 6)\002"
no_color="\001$(tput sgr0)\002" no_color="\001$(tput sgr0)\002"
else
red="\[\033[1;31m\]"
green="\[\033[1;32m\]"
yellow="\[\033[1;33m\]"
blue="\[\033[1;34m\]"
magenta="\[\033[1;35m\]"
cyan="\[\033[1;36m\]"
no_color="\[\033[0m\]"
fi
export PS1="${green}\$${no_color} " export PS1="${green}\$${no_color} "